Patent number: 11054764Abstract: An image forming apparatus includes a storage case, a developer conveyance portion, a developer detecting portion, a time measuring portion, and a driving control portion. The storage case stores developer that is supplied to a developing device, and conveys the developer by driving a first conveyance member. The developer conveyance portion conveys, by driving a second conveyance member, the developer supplied from the storage case. The developer detecting portion is provided in the developing device and detects the developer supplied from the developer conveyance portion. The time measuring portion measures a required time between a time when the first conveyance member starts to be driven and a time when the developer detecting portion detects the developer. The driving control portion sets a driving time of the second conveyance member based on the required time measured by the time measuring portion.Type: GrantFiled: June 5, 2020Date of Patent: July 6, 2021Assignee: KYOCERA Document Solutions Inc.Inventor: Atsuya Ikeuchi

Patent number: 11048197Abstract: An image forming apparatus includes a developer container, an agitator, a toner supply, a toner sensor, and a controller. The developer container contains a two-component developer that includes toner and carrier. The agitator stirs the two-component developer. The toner supply replenishes the developer container with additional toner. The toner sensor detects a toner density of the two-component developer in the developer container. The controller calibrates the toner sensor using the two-component developer. The controller compares a first detection value indicating a toner density at a first time with a second detection value indicating a toner density at a second time after a predetermined time period has elapsed since the first time. The controller issues a notification regarding a suitability of calibration based on a comparison result of the first detection value and the second detection value.Type: GrantFiled: March 5, 2020Date of Patent: June 29, 2021Assignee: TOSHIBA TEC KABUSHIKI KAISHAInventor: Kei Onishi

Patent number: 10996606Abstract: A remaining toner amount detecting apparatus includes two electrodes; a remaining toner amount detector configured to detect a remaining toner amount in a toner container based on a capacitance between the two electrodes; a storage configured to store a first capacitance value between the two electrodes preliminarily detected in a non-disposed state in which the toner container is not disposed between the two electrodes; and an abnormality detector configured to detect an abnormality of the remaining toner amount detecting apparatus based on the first capacitance value stored in the storage and a second capacitance value between the two electrodes that is detected in the non-disposed state.Type: GrantFiled: December 13, 2019Date of Patent: May 4, 2021Assignee: Ricoh Company, Ltd.Inventor: Yuji Ieiri

Patent number: 10775729Abstract: A remaining toner amount detecting apparatus detects a remaining toner amount in a toner bottle. The remaining toner amount detecting apparatus includes at least one pair of electrodes that are configured to face each other with the toner bottle interposed between the electrodes; a first estimator configured to estimate the remaining toner amount based on a capacitance between the electrodes of the at least one pair of electrodes; a second estimator configured to estimate the remaining toner amount by counting a number of pixels in a printed image; and an estimation selector configured to use either one of the first estimator or the second estimator to output the remaining toner amount, based on a temperature or a humidity inside an apparatus in which the toner bottle is mounted.Type: GrantFiled: January 15, 2020Date of Patent: September 15, 2020Assignee: Ricoh Company, Ltd.Inventors: Tetsuya Hara, Masashi Hommi, Yuji Ieiri, Takumi Miyagawa

Patent number: 10558156Abstract: A base toner amount is determined without taking edge effect into account, and corresponds to a pixel value of image data for which gradation correction has not been performed. For the base toner amount, a first spatial filter process is performed corresponding to a laser profile of the exposure device. A second spatial filter process is performed for the base toner amount before or after the first spatial filter process and thereby an edge emphasis amount is determined corresponding to the edge effect. A limiter processing unit limits the edge emphasis amount to an uppermost value or less, and the uppermost value corresponds to the base toner amount after the first spatial filter process. A toner counter counts as a toner consumption amount a sum of the base toner amount after the first spatial filter process and the edge emphasis amount.Type: GrantFiled: September 6, 2018Date of Patent: February 11, 2020Assignee: Kyocera Document Solutions, Inc.Inventors: Toshiaki Mutsuo, Hiroki Tanaka, Takayuki Mashimo
